Last day in the big apple. Wake up and pack last things, then I go uptown to do a final shop. Back to the apartment, re-pack and then out of the apartment at the designated 1200. Few pics of the apartment. This was a good place with great views. Car not due till 1300 so we go down to the cafe under the building for some lunch.

Order and start eating when we see our car arrive with the driver we had when we came back from Niagara Falls (he dropped us off here). Finish food and out to the car, get bags from the doorman at the apartments and away we go out of Manhattan for the last time on this trip. Jean (our driver) takes us out and across the bridge instead of through the Lincoln tunnels - said that would be hectic. See another side of the city and go past La Guardia airport on our way around to JFK. Freeway blocked so next thing we are in the suburbs through back streets then back onto the freeway. good to know he knows his way around and we are not on a meter....

Get to the airport, check in, then go to the bag drop. First bag 38 lbs, second bag 48 lbs, third bag 53 lbs - oh oh, lady suggests we move some stuff around. Stuff that went in last (cleaning and some purchases) were the difference. Moved them into the new bag and all good now. Through security, much easier this time as we are leaving USA.

Down to the gate and wait. Did a bit of shop looking but no purchases here. Went to a bar and got some drinks to farewell NYC. Chris got a bubbles and the server said it looked pretty. Chris said it would look even better with a strawberry. Next thing she gets a bowl of berries. Nice. Board on time and away to LAX for our home bound flight. Well almost, sit for a while, then pilot comes on and says the aero bridge won't detach from the plane - waiting. Finally it moves at least 30 minutes after we were due to take off. Then we get held at a taxiway because they are changing runways or something. While we sit I count at least 8 planes that go past. In the end we move and the pilot says we haven't lost too much time and he will not hold back the horses on the way to LA.

Sit behind the exit row - teasing us... 2 guys arrive, Aussies who had been to the World Cup in Brazil. Plenty of chat to the 3rd guy in the row. Not too bad, sceptical the dude in front of me kept getting up then dropping back into the seat nearly crushing my legs. Hmmmm.

Arrive at LAX on time so he did let the horses have their head. Our next gate is 3 down from where we landed - good one. Look at shops again, then decide to get something to eat. Order food and eat that, then they are about to start boarding. We have "comfort" seats which give us priority boarding so we are on after the business class people. Nice.

Our seat is right behind business class and we have the first seat in the middle behind a bulkhead - plenty of room and only 3 abreast. American guy beside Chris who seems ok, looks like he will settle in and go to sleep - correct. Away pretty much on time and all the service on board is good.

Australia here we come.
